CANDIDATE FORUM TODAY!

Brewster County Candidate Forum, Monday, October 10, 2022, 5:30 pm at the Red Pattillo Community Center in Study Butte. This forum is to present to the public in the South Brewster County area the Republican and Democratic candidates for County Judge, County Commissioner Precinct 2, and JP Precinct 2. 


The candidates are, in ballot order:

For Brewster County Judge – Greg Henington and Oscar Cobos

For Brewster County Commissioner Precinct 2 – Mark Chiles and Sara Colando

For Justice of Peace Precinct 2 – Paul Rashott and Tim Relleva


The Moderators will be Nate Gold and John Smietana. Questions will come from the public.


In case you are unable to attend the forum inStudy Butte tonight, a second Brewster County Candidate Forum will be held next week in Alpine on October 17, 2022, 5:30 pm, at the AISD Auditorium, 704 West Sul Ross Ave, Alpine, for the same slate of candidates. A moderator has not yet been selected for the Oct. 17 forum.


TODAY IS VOTER REGISTRATION DEADLINE!

To be able to vote in the November 8 election, you must register by TODAY, OCTOBER 11– that means the application has to be in the Alpine election office by today. There are applications at the Terlingua Post Office, just ask at the counter. Make sure to fill it out COMPLETELY, including phone number, to ensure your vote will count.
